1 | // SPDX-License-Identifier: GPL-2.0 |
2 | /* |
3 | * Copyright 2018, Breno Leitao, Gustavo Romero, IBM Corp. |
4 | * |
5 | * A test case that creates a signal and starts a suspended transaction |
6 | * inside the signal handler. |
7 | * |
8 | * It returns from the signal handler with the CPU at suspended state, but |
9 | * without setting usercontext MSR Transaction State (TS) fields. |
10 | */ |
11 | |
12 | #define _GNU_SOURCE |
13 | #include <stdio.h> |
14 | #include <stdlib.h> |
15 | #include <signal.h> |
16 | |
17 | #include "utils.h" |
18 | #include "tm.h" |
19 | |
20 | void trap_signal_handler(int signo, siginfo_t *si, void *uc) |
21 | { |
22 | ucontext_t *ucp = (ucontext_t *) uc; |
23 | |
24 | asm("tbegin.; tsuspend.;" ); |
25 | |
26 | /* Skip 'trap' instruction if it succeed */ |
27 | ucp->uc_mcontext.regs->nip += 4; |
28 | } |
29 | |
30 | int tm_signal_sigreturn_nt(void) |
31 | { |
32 | struct sigaction trap_sa; |
33 | |
34 | SKIP_IF(!have_htm()); |
35 | SKIP_IF(htm_is_synthetic()); |
36 | |
37 | trap_sa.sa_flags = SA_SIGINFO; |
38 | trap_sa.sa_sigaction = trap_signal_handler; |
39 | |
40 | sigaction(SIGTRAP, &trap_sa, NULL); |
41 | |
42 | raise(SIGTRAP); |
43 | |
44 | return EXIT_SUCCESS; |
45 | } |
46 | |
47 | int main(int argc, char **argv) |
48 | { |
49 | test_harness(tm_signal_sigreturn_nt, "tm_signal_sigreturn_nt" ); |
50 | } |
